In 2021, Dtravel introduced TRVL (TRVL), aiming to address challenges in the travel industry, including trust, reputation, distribution, connectivity, and direct bookings.
As an ecosystem empowering ownership in travel, TRVL plays a crucial role in revolutionizing the travel sector.
As of 2025, TRVL has become an integral part of the Dtravel ecosystem, providing community members, travelers, and travel businesses with various ways to participate in the product ecosystem.

TRVL operates on a decentralized network, freeing it from control by traditional travel industry intermediaries.
This decentralized approach ensures system transparency and resilience, giving users greater autonomy in their travel experiences.
TRVL's blockchain serves as a public, immutable digital ledger recording all transactions within the Dtravel ecosystem.
Transactions are grouped into blocks and linked through cryptographic hashing, forming a secure chain.
Anyone can view records, establishing trust without intermediaries.
TRVL utilizes blockchain technology to validate transactions, preventing fraudulent activities in the travel booking process.
Participants in the Dtravel ecosystem contribute to network security and receive TRVL rewards for their participation.

As of November 25, 2025, TRVL's circulating supply is 454,454,225.3735702 tokens, with a total supply of 1,000,000,000 tokens.
TRVL reached its all-time high of $1.56 on November 28, 2021.
Its lowest price was $0.00264663, recorded on November 25, 2025.
These fluctuations reflect market sentiments, adoption trends, and external factors.
